Nicki Minaj has recently offered her loyal fanbase some insight into her youth when he was asked what advice she might offer her younger self.

On Sunday (April 23), a Nicki Minaj fan account asked the Queens native whether she was satisfied with life right now and what advice she would give a younger version of herself.

According to the Pinkprint rapper, she has “everything I prayed for” and would tell her younger self not to worry so much about the future and to “hold on” because she’ll eventually “have the best fans on earth.”

But everything isn’t all rosy for Nicki these days. Last week, her name was brought up in relation to a new vaccine bill introduced by a controversial congressman.

George Santos, the U.S. representative for New York’s third congressional district who has a history of misleading the public, announced The Minaj Act on Monday (April 17) to “establish a development period for new vaccines in order to generate public confidence.”

Reporter Kadia Goba tweeted: “Ahem. Rep. George Santos just dropped seven bills in the hopper. Among them, The Minaj Act, named for — yes, you guessed it — rapper Nikki [sic] Minaj that establishes a development period for new vaccines in order to generate public confidence.”

Nicki has yet to address the bill.
